Recently I've been finding a lot of studies suggesting Fibromyalgia may be caused by a dysfunction of the hippocampus. The hippocampus plays a crucial role in the bodies regulation of pain, memories and sleep. Stress also plays a huge role in the function of the hippocampus, and when stressful events occur our bodies release glucocorticoid hormones, specifically cortisol. I'm trying to understand more about the causes of Fibromyalgia specifically in relation to the function of the hippocampus. Anyone else out there researching this or have any information? Thanks
